Waterway safety zone lifted

Updated: Monday, 14 Jan 2013, 6:31 AM EST
Published : Saturday, 12 Jan 2013, 3:08 PM EST

CHESAPEAKE, Va. (WAVY) - A temporary safety zone at the Intracoastal Waterway for all recreational and commercial maritime traffic
near the Gilmerton Bridge has been lifted by the Coast Guard.

The Coast Guard re-opened the maritime channel after a five day closure that began on Jan. 7 to accommodate the Gilmerton Bridge lift span float in and the span's connection to the tower structures, according to a press release from VDOT.

The bridge remains closed to vehicular traffic until January 20 as crews prepare the new span.

VDOT recommends that travelers use the I-64 High Rise Bridge or the South Norfolk Jordan Bridge as alternate routes.
